
Guest Service
Client Spotlight: Kickapoo Lucky Eagle Casino Hotel
What an Idea. A Crazy, Mad, Wonderful Idea! A little background on this property: Kickapoo Lucky Eagle Casino Hotel, located in Eagle Pass, Texas, is proudly owned by the Kickapoo Traditional Tribe of Texas. It […]